## Changelog — v3.2.0 (Hapsley Design System)

Renamed CONTRAST_CHECK_LEVEL to A11Y_CONTRAST_TIER following the Quarrow color-contrast audit. Accepted values are unchanged (aa, aaa). If you're a new contractor picking up audit tickets: old configs still work until v3.4, but a deprecation warning is logged at startup. Update your local .env to use the new name. The audit reporter also pushes results to the Quarrow dashboard, so append its credential on the next line:

sealed setting: ARCHIVE_KEY3=8d0

Hi folks,

Quick update on the Textwell upload pipeline: we've switched encoding detection from header sniffing to full-content analysis, so those garbled Latin-1 files from the Corvale partners should finally render correctly. Support will probably see fewer "weird characters" tickets, but a few legacy UTF-16 files may now get flagged for manual review instead of silently mangled — that's intentional.

If you want to replay a stuck file through the sandbox detector, authenticate with the token below.

bearer token for tawig-bahif: eyJhbGciOiJIUzI1NiIsInR5cCI6IkpXVCJ9.eyJzdWIiOiIo-yiO33jvEIn0.T9qLInSAqhTN

Leadership Review Briefing — Sales Leads

Short version: we're moving tier-one support for the Bramblewick suite to an external partner in Q2. Response times should improve, and your teams stop fielding stray tickets. Escalations stay in-house with Deva's crew. Full FAQ coming next week. There's one confidential piece, noted just below.

board note of tadup-tajog: Headcount on the Oliiel team goes from 31 to 88 by the end of February. Gross margin on Oliiel came in at 62 percent against a plan of 29 percent.

## Cold Start Procedure

During rollout of the Ferncastle handlers, expect elevated cold-start latency for roughly ten minutes as the Brindlemoor platform provisions warm pools. Do not rotate credentials mid-window; provisioning retries will fail closed. All handler bundles are signed at build time, and cold-started instances verify each bundle against the key below.

deploy key for kajof-fajop: bky6_gDHw9Q